From: Jeff Layton Date: Tue, 12 Feb 2008 16:47:24 +0000 (-0500) Subject: SUNRPC: allow svc_recv to break out of 500ms sleep when alloc_page fails X-Git-Tag: v2.6.26-rc1~1083^2~35 X-Git-Url: http://git.openpandora.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=7b54fe61ffd5bfa4e50d371a2415225aa0cbb38e;p=pandora-kernel.git SUNRPC: allow svc_recv to break out of 500ms sleep when alloc_page fails svc_recv() calls alloc_page(), and if it fails it does a 500ms uninterruptible sleep and then reattempts. There doesn't seem to be any real reason for this to be uninterruptible, so change it to an interruptible sleep. Also check for kthread_stop() and signalled() after setting the task state to avoid races that might lead to sleeping after kthread_stop() wakes up the task. I've done some very basic smoke testing with this, but obviously it's hard to test the actual changes since this all depends on an alloc_page() call failing.
